Bruni sits in the middle of the South Texas brush country, where summer temperatures regularly exceed 100 degrees F from May through October and annual rainfall averages only about 18 to 20 inches. That heat-and-drought combination stresses trees hard. Dead wood accumulates in the canopy faster than it would in a wetter climate, and root systems weaken when the soil dries out and contracts for months at a stretch. When hail and high winds arrive with the spring thunderstorm season, trees that have been heat-stressed all summer are the most likely to fail. On rural lots where homes and outbuildings are spread across open land, a falling tree covers a lot of ground.
The soil conditions in this part of Webb County add pressure from below. Clay soils in South Texas shrink during dry periods and swell back when rain finally comes - that repeated movement shifts foundations, cracks concrete pads, and works tree roots under fencing and driveways over time. Manufactured homes, which make up a meaningful share of the housing stock in rural communities like Bruni, are particularly sensitive to foundation movement and to limb strikes because their structural framing is lighter than site-built construction. (956) 815-3902Bruni is a small unincorporated community in Webb County, Texas, located about 60 miles north of Laredo. With a population well under 1,000, it is one of the smaller rural communities in the county. There is no city government - residents deal directly with Webb County for property records, permits, and public services. The housing stock is a mix of older site-built homes from the 1950s through the 1980s and manufactured housing, both of which are common in rural South Texas communities. Most properties are owner-occupied and sit on large lots or small acreage. The area sits above the Eagle Ford Shale formation, and the energy industry has shaped the local economy and workforce for decades.
The community is predominantly Hispanic, and Spanish is widely spoken in this part of Webb County. Like all of South Texas brush country, the land around Bruni is dominated by mesquite, huisache, and prickly pear on undeveloped lots and along fence lines.
